Services at Recurring Eternal Insights

At Recurring Eternal Insights (REI), spiritual aid is offered primarily through written teaching and structured guidance. There is no emphasis on expensive public profiles, videos, or personality‑driven programs. The focus is on the content, your growth, and your relationship with God—not on the image of any teacher.

All services flow from two complementary streams:Judeo‑Christian Path – Bible‑rooted, monotheistic teaching for serious disciples.

Sacred Oracle Path – A universal, God‑centered framework for judgment, balance, and leadership.

Below are the main ways you can receive help.

Written Doctrinal and Life Guidance

Judeo‑Christian Doctrine & Church Order Q&A

For:

Disciples, pastors, Bible teachers, and serious students who want clear, Scripture‑based answers to doctrinal and practical church questions.

Typical topics include:

The nature of God, Christ, and the Holy Spirit (monotheism, Christology, divinity in Christ).

Salvation, repentance, faith, obedience, and judgment in light of the whole Bible.

Biblical church structure: elders, deacons, apostles, councils, discipline, and leadership accountability.

How to interpret difficult passages and reconcile apparent contradictions.

How it works:

You submit your questions in writing (email or form).

You receive a written response that:

Explains the issue clearly.

Provides relevant Scripture references and, where helpful, brief notes on original language or translation issues.

Aims for coherence with the overall biblical narrative and doctrine.

This service is especially useful for pastors and leaders who want to ensure their teaching and church practice align with a consistent, Bible‑based theology, ecclesiology, and divinity.

Sacred Oracle Judgment Calibration

 

For:

Seekers, leaders, and mediators who want a God‑centered, rational method for making complex decisions in life, relationships, work, or ministry.

 

Typical situations include:

Major life decisions (career changes, relocation, relationships, business directions).

Ethical and moral dilemmas where right and wrong are not obvious.

Leadership conflicts, team decisions, or community challenges.

Personal struggles with extremes (addictions, overwork, passivity, emotional chaos) and a desire for balanced, sustainable living.

 

How it works:

 

You describe your situation in writing, including:

The decision or dilemma you face.What you’ve tried so far.Your goals, fears, and constraints.

 

You receive a written analysis that:

Maps the situation on the ternary spectrum (opposing extremes and the wise, God‑aligned center).

Identifies inferior, superior, and intermediate “programming” patterns at work.

Offers concrete recommendations for judgment, action, and follow‑up.

This service applies Sacred Oracle’s comprehensive framework to your specific context, helping you make wiser, more balanced choices under God’s governance...
